以下程序将
实现从键盘 输入12个 整型数据, 组成一个3 行4列的二 维数组并输 出。mai n (){ int a [3][4 ]; in t i,j ;for( i=0;_ _____ __;i+ +)for (j=0; _____ ___;j ++)sc anf(“ %d”,_ _____ __);f or(i= 0;___ _____ ;i++) for(j =0;__ _____ _;j++ )prin tf(“% d”,__ _____ _);pi rntf( “”); }编程题: :i小编还为您整理了以下内容,可能对您也有帮助:
创建一个3行4列的二维整型数组,通过初始化为数组元素赋初值,计算最大元素要求
#include <stdio.h>
int main() {
int arr[3][4] = {{1, 2, 3, 4}, {5, 6, 7, 8}, {9, 10, 11, 12}};
int max = arr[0][0]; // 假设数组的第一个元素为最大值
// 遍历数组,查找最大值
for (int i = 0; i < 3; i++) {
for (int j = 0; j < 4; j++) {
if (arr[i][j] > max) {
max = arr[i][j];
}
}
}
printf("最大值为:%d\n", max);
return 0;
}
在上面的代码中,我们首先定义了一个3行4列的二维整型数组 arr,并将其初始化为特定的值。接着,我们定义一个变量 max,用于存储数组中的最大值,我们假设数组的第一个元素为最大值。然后,我们使用两个嵌套的循环来遍历数组,查找最大值,如果找到了一个比当前最大值 max 更大的元素,就将 max 更新为这个元素的值。最后,我们输出最大值。